Output 298528d432a8e2b50ef6fbe1716a06282f7677e17450dfd4cb9e70ed37c54de9:3

value
28839966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491b4e7db6f4030407a2511369d740c731599040 OP_EQUAL
address
MEZiGjJ6ssaK3MYu7KYPcbuVdDHq4yas2i
transaction
298528d432a8e2b50ef6fbe1716a06282f7677e17450dfd4cb9e70ed37c54de9
spent
true